United B752 at Shannon on Jul 11th 2016, unsafe main gear

A United Boeing 757-200, registration N29129 performing flight UA-25 (dep Jul 10th) from Newark,NJ (USA) to Shannon (Ireland) with 172 people on board, was on final approach to Shannon's runway 24 when the crew went around and entered a hold to work their checklists. After completing the checklists the crew reported the right hand main gear did not indicate green (down and locked), however, they were confident that the gear was down and locked, they were declaring emergency now and advised they would need to full length of the runway. They would not perform a low approach but go for a full stop landing right away. The aircraft landed safely on runway 24 and stopped for an inspection of the gear before turning around to backtrack the runway to the apron.

The occurrence aircraft remained on the ground for 3:45 hours then was able to depart for its next sector UA-67 to Chicago O'Hare,IL (USA).
